How To Fix /SAPAPO/CMDS_EDIBAPI030 - Processing and current del. schedule number in the database are identical


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PAPO/CMDS_EDIBAPI -

  • Message number: 030

  • Message text: Processing and current del. schedule number in the database are identical

    The SAP error message /SAPAPO/CMDS_EDIBAPI030 typically indicates that there is an issue with the processing of a delivery schedule in the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) module. The specific message "Processing and current delivery schedule number in the database are identical" suggests that the system is trying to process a delivery schedule that is already being processed or has not been updated correctly.

    Cause:

    1. Duplicate Processing: The error often occurs when there is an attempt to process a delivery schedule that is already in the system, leading to a conflict.
    2. Data Consistency Issues: There may be inconsistencies in the database where the delivery schedule is not updated properly, causing the system to recognize the same schedule number as both current and being processed.
    3. Concurrency Issues: If multiple processes are trying to access or modify the same delivery schedule simultaneously, it can lead to this error.

    Solution:

    1. Check for Duplicate Processes: Ensure that there are no other processes currently working on the same delivery schedule. If there are, wait for them to complete before trying again.
    2. Database Consistency Check: Perform a consistency check on the database to ensure that the delivery schedule data is accurate and up-to-date. This may involve running specific SAP transactions or reports to identify and resolve inconsistencies.
    3. Reprocess the Delivery Schedule: If the delivery schedule is stuck in a processing state, you may need to cancel the current processing and re-initiate it. This can often be done through the relevant transaction codes in SAP.
    4. Review Logs and Traces: Check the application logs and traces for any additional error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.
    5. Consult SAP Notes: Look for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message. SAP frequently updates its knowledge base with solutions for known issues.
    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ot find a resolution,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ance.
